What is Stripe?
Stripe is an online payment processing tool that enables businesses, regardless of their size, to accept credit cards, debit cards, and various payment methods worldwide. With its user-friendly APIs, no-code payment options, and software solutions, it empowers companies to quickly launch, test, and scale their revenue.
It offers a range of features, such as recurring billing, marketplace setup, and integrated global payments. Developers can easily build integrations using Stripe’s modern tools and focus on improving customer experiences.
Stripe supports over 135 currencies and multiple payment methods, including cards and alternative options like ACH transfers, Alipay, and Giropay. The platform provides flexible billing models, customizable subscription logic, and pricing structures.
Users can manage subscriptions, invoices, and financial reports from the dashboard, and Stripe’s Connect feature facilitates routing, payouts, and advanced payment flows.
Its benefits include a customizable checkout experience, support for major card networks, simplified reconciliation, real-time transaction information, and numerous integrations. It serves global businesses across various industries, from startups to established organizations.

User Sentiment - Stripe Reviews
-
Ease of Integration
Stripe is frequently praised for its robust API and ease of integration. Developers appreciate the clear documentation, which makes it simple to embed payment processing into websites and mobile applications with minimal hassle.
-
Comprehensive Feature Set
Stripe offers a wide range of payment options, including support for credit cards, mobile wallets, and alternative payment methods like ACH and SEPA. Its robust feature set also includes invoicing, subscriptions, and fraud prevention tools, which many users find helpful.
-
Global Reach and Multi-Currency Support
Many international businesses appreciate Stripe’s ability to process payments in various currencies and support multiple payment methods. This global compatibility makes it an ideal choice for companies with customers worldwide.
-
Transparent Pricing
Users often highlight Stripe’s transparent pricing model, which includes no hidden fees. The pay-as-you-go structure (typically around 2.9% + $0.30 per transaction) makes it easy for businesses to understand and predict costs, which helps with budgeting.
-
Strong Security and Compliance
Another area where Stripe receives praise is its focus on security. With PCI compliance, data encryption, and advanced fraud detection, users feel confident in Stripe’s ability to handle sensitive payment data safely and securely.
-
Customer Support
One of the most common complaints is about Stripe’s customer support. Some users report slow response times and difficulty reaching a representative when they face critical issues. This can be a significant drawback for businesses handling a high volume of transactions.
-
Complex Dispute Process
A few users mention handling disputes (chargebacks) can be cumbersome and slow through Stripe’s platform. In some cases, the lack of proactive communication can leave businesses feeling uninformed during disputes.
-
Higher Fees for Certain Payment Methods
While Stripe’s base fees are transparent, some users have noted that specific payment methods, such as international transactions or currency conversions, charge higher fees. This can lead to unexpected costs for businesses handling cross-border payments.
-
Learning Curve for Non-Developers
Although developers find Stripe’s API easy to work with, non-technical users sometimes find the platform’s extensive feature set overwhelming. This complexity can make it difficult for smaller businesses without dedicated technical resources to leverage the platform entirely.
-
Account Holds and Freezes
A few users have experienced account holds or freezes due to Stripe’s risk assessment processes. While these measures are meant to prevent fraud, businesses can be frustrated by sudden interruptions in service without clear communication.
